Gujarat Titans and Delhi Capitals have faced each other five times in the Indian Premier League. DC leads the head-to-head with three wins, while GT has secured two victories.
At the Narendra Modi Stadium in Ahmedabad, the teams have met twice. DC emerged victorious on both occasions, winning by 5 runs in 2023 and by 6 wickets in 2024.
Over the past five seasons, DC has had the upper hand, clinching three out of five encounters. Their most recent win was a close 4-run victory in Delhi during the 2024 season.

Sai Sudharsan (GT): Sudharsan has been in great form this season, consistently scoring runs at the top. His solid batting has helped Gujarat Titans post strong totals. He is currently the second-highest run scorer with 329 runs in six matches, just 38 runs behind Nicholas Pooran, who has played seven games.
Mitchell Starc (DC): Starc played a key role in Delhi Capitals’ last win against Rajasthan Royals, bowling a tight final over and an outstanding Super Over. He is now Delhi’s leading wicket-taker with 10 wickets in just six matches this season.
